I have a question regarding my glock 22.Is it true that a glock 22 can be converted to shoot a .357 SIG bullet by replacing the barrel from a glock 31. is this a urban legend of some sort? if it is not , then what else do i need to change in the glock 22 apart from the barre to shoot a 357 bulletl.

Re: Glock 22 /Glock 31
All you need to do is change the barrel. You don't even need to change the magazines unless you feel like it. By the way, the .357 SIG to .40 S&W conversion works the same way. Just swap the barrel. It all works because .357 SIG is essentially a .40 S&W case necked down to take a 9mm bullet.
